Sticker price is not cost. I don't care if you're evaluating a new Komatsu excavator, a remanufactured AC compressor, or a search for a Komatsu forklift parts manual PDF: the quote in front of you is only the first line of the real expense sheet. In commercial construction and mining, the cheapest option on paper is often the most expensive one on the job site.

I'm a parts procurement coordinator at a heavy equipment dealership in Nevada. I've handled more than 200 rush orders in eight years, including same-day turnarounds for mining clients, and I've watched this mistake happen repeatedly. Not the 'wrong brand' mistake. The 'I only compared the invoice' mistake.

When I Was Wrong About Price

When I first started in this job, I assumed the lowest quote was the smart purchase. That's what procurement training taught me to think. But in 2022, a budget AC compressor for a wheel loader looked like a smart $300 save. It failed within a month, took the belt and an idler pulley with it, and left the loader down for two days in the middle of paving season. The total cost of that 'savings' was over $1,900 once I added replacement labor, the second AC compressor, the tow to the shop, and the three loads that had to be rerouted.

I didn't fully understand total cost of ownership until that failure. Since then, I've used a simple mental rule: price is what you pay at the counter. Cost is what you pay when the dust settles.

TCO Is Not Complicated—It's Just Complete

Total cost of ownership includes everything tied to a purchase:

  • Purchase price
  • Freight and expediting
  • Installation labor and tooling
  • Expected maintenance over the ownership period
  • Downtime risk and the cost of a breakdown
  • Resale value at the end of the asset's life

Notice that price is first but not biggest. For heavy equipment, the biggest line items are usually downtime and repair risk. That's why a part can be 'cheap' and still lose you money by the end of the week.

The Forklift Parts Manual PDF Trap

Another good example is material handling equipment. In the last quarter, I've taken calls from fleet managers who found a Komatsu forklift parts manual PDF online and circled a part number. That's a good starting point. The manual helps you identify the correct group of parts and the original part number. But the PDF is not the final answer.

We had a customer order a hydraulic filter from an aftermarket supplier because the part number in their Komatsu forklift parts manual PDF seemed to match. It was not the same spec. The filter looked right, threaded on fine, and then collapsed at around 600 hours. The repair bill for the hydrostatic pump was just under $3,800. The 'saving' on the filter? Twenty-two dollars.

That's not an argument against every aftermarket part. It's an argument for verifying the specification before you sign. If the part has a Komatsu number on a third-party box, ask for the same load specs, pressure specs, and material certifications. If the vendor can't answer, you're not buying a compatible part; you're buying a guess.

AC Compressors: Small Part, Big TCO

Let's go smaller. An AC compressor for a cab sounds minor compared to a final drive or a mining bucket. But in Nevada, an operator in a broken AC cab isn't just uncomfortable—they lose focus, take longer breaks, and in extreme heat it becomes a safety issue. I've seen a rebuilt AC compressor save a customer $400 upfront. I've also seen a seized compressor take out the drive belt, the idler, and the fan hub. That's not a $400 savings; that's a $1,200 repair plus two days of operator discomfort.

Sometimes the cheap part is fine. Not ideal, but workable. In that case, buy it. The problem is that you can't know that until you compare the specification, not just the price. I kept asking myself after that first compressor failure: is saving $300 worth risking a loader during peak season? The answer was no. The upside was small. The downside was a two-day shutdown.

Looking back, I should have checked the failure history before ordering that first budget compressor. But at the time, the price gap was too tempting. That's what sticker price thinking does: it makes bad decisions feel smart.

Even freight matters. In March 2024, a client needed a final drive for a Komatsu excavator on a remote job site. Standard LTL delivery was six days. We found the part in stock, paid $1,550 to put it on a dedicated flatbed truck, and the part arrived in 22 hours. The shipping cost was high. It was also the cheapest option, because the downtime cost under their contract was $4,500 per day. The cheap option would have been the expensive one.

I Don't Have Time for TCO Math

I hear that a lot. A machine is down, a deadline is close, and the last thing anyone wants is a procurement lecture. I get it. You need the part moving, not a spreadsheet.

But TCO doesn't require a spreadsheet. It requires one question: if this part fails, what does the failure cost?

If the answer is low, buy the budget part and move on. If the answer is high, spend the extra money on a proven part and move on faster. The mistake is not asking the question because you're in a hurry. That's exactly when the hidden costs are biggest.
